We’re adding an auxiliary limit switch to a fixture that resides on this machine.
I’m kind of new to circuit boards, but it looks like I need a couple of terminal blocks and some jumpers to move forward with the installation.
Which terminal block and jumper do I need to order to fit on the highlighted locations?
How do I choose what I need? There are a ton of different configurations, and I’m confused about what to order.
Does Centroid sell these parts?

Re: NEEDING HELP REGARDING CIRCUIT BOARD PARTS
So, the DC3IO should have been shipped with the jumper blocks for J11, J12, J13, and J14. These are common parts but since we have a sell price for them, I think we can sell you some. Our part number for those jumper blocks is 1761.
H12 is a connector that requires crimping. Our part number for the requisite 8 pin housing is 1295 and the terminals is 1477.

Re: NEEDING HELP REGARDING CIRCUIT BOARD PARTS
You'd want to crimp the wires on using a CST-100 series compatible crimper and then they push to insert into the housing.
